X and Y contain 35 litres and 50 litres of mixtures of liquids A and B respectively. The total quantity of B in both the mixtures is 30 litres. Quantity of A in mixture X is 15 litres less than the quantity of A in mixture Y. If 20% of the liquid is taken from mixture X and put into mixture Y, then what will be the ratio of A to B in mixture Y? Correct Answer 13 : 6

Let the quantity of liquid A in mixture X = x litres

∴ The quantity of liquid A in mixture Y = x + 15 litres

∴ x + x + 15 + 30 = 50 + 35

⇒ 2x = 40

⇒ x = 20 litres

Quantity of A in X = 20 litres

Quantity of B in X = 35 – 20 = 15 litres

Quantity of A in Y = 20 + 15 = 35 litres

Quantity of B in Y = 15 litres
